Pros: The SUV is an 8 seater with a V8 engine and a smooth ride. Cons: The price of the SUV and that it doesn't come with a V6. The Bottom Line: Great SUV if you have the money to spend.
The Land Cruiser is a great vehicle with a lot of horse power but it is very bulky in size and only comes in a V8 which a V6 would be nice for the customers that doesn't want all the horse and the low gas mileage with the V8. I rented this vehicle once...
